Output 34abc1871145248ccf50c33c8e540cce4bb4cee61ea43d34d14d16017ecbef7b:0

value
5044894
script pubkey
OP_HASH160 OP_PUSHBYTES_20 386a51bc2aca7797ee103cefb9b24f6c1695a586 OP_EQUAL
address
36qK8Uk9hoC7KGyrVBQYE1U3yDCvjxajrE
transaction
34abc1871145248ccf50c33c8e540cce4bb4cee61ea43d34d14d16017ecbef7b
spent
true